Dell support assist can be uninstalled and reinstalled Not having these partitions could affect dell support if ever needed, and, as previously noted, make a full disc image (all partitions) to a separate drive before doing anything with the drive. The dell support assist is useful for drivers, updating bios, recalls, etc

So update drivers and bios before uninstalling the software. May even affect the post (power on self test) as the dell support assist is part of the post Dell support assist is the work of the devil

I would suggest cleanly removing both support assist and support assist os recovery via the control panel

Then enable the hidden items view in windows explorer and look at your os (c) drive for the programdata and appdata folders.
